
Yan Ohayon
1 reviews on 1 places
Absolutely the best spot for scooters in Bermuda. Best prices, incredible service, great well maintained scooters but, above all, incredible owners. Carlos and Carlos Jr are total gentlemen, so kind and will give you incredible service. Can't wait to come back to bermuda for another round with these guys!